Funding requests  for medical equipment

Please complete the attached funding application form, including quotations from three different suppliers and a supporting letter from the head of your institution. If three supplier quotations are not available, kindly explain the reason in the "Other Information" section of the form.

The Charity presently aims to fund items up to a maximum total of £4,000 per annum. However, the Committee may consider applications for items exceeding this amount if they are deemed suitable for future fundraising initiatives and are consistent with the Charity’s stated aims and objectives. Please note that, in accordance with its standard policy, the Charity does not make cash donations under any circumstances.

Applications that are incomplete will not be considered. In specific instances, a member of the Charity’s local committee in Sri Lanka may contact the applicant to request additional information. Wherever feasible, items will be procured within Sri Lanka to ensure the availability of local support for repairs and maintenance. Applicants are expected to conduct a thorough assessment of the equipment’s compatibility and its appropriateness for use within the hospital setting. All correspondence and inquiries should be directed to the Secretary of the Charity via the medicalaidtosrilanka@googlegroups.com email address.

Please also note: Should the MASL Committee approve the donation of equipment, a certified copy of the official hospital inventory record endorsed by the head of the hospital must be submitted to the Secretary of Medical Aid to Sri Lanka within eight weeks of receipt of the equipment via the above email address.
